Quaker Buildings Walk

Train-assisted walk!

Here’s another chance to explore Newham’s rich Quaker history on foot and possibly spot the Quaker Fox along the way!

The walk visits some of the buildings, or their former locations, featured in our April 2026 Newham u3a talk. Whether you missed the talk or simply need your memory refreshing, walk leader Gregory will share some brief details at each stop.

At a glance

Date: Friday 4 September 2026

Meet: Plaistow Tube Station at 10.30am, ready for a prompt 10.45am start

Remember – ONLY Gregory can be late!

Route: Plaistow Station to Wanstead Quaker Meeting House, Bush Road, E11

Distance: Approximately 7½ km/4¾ miles

Duration: Approximately 4½ hours, including stops

Terrain: Mostly flat pavements, with some more uneven ground across Wanstead Flats and through Epping Forest

This is a train-assisted walk, with a train journey between Stratford and Manor Park, so please bring your Freedom Pass or Travelcard.

What to bring

  • Suitable footwear
  • Water and refreshments
  • Clothing appropriate for the forecast whether that means sun protection or rainwear
  • Your Freedom Pass or Travelcard


Toilets should be available in West Ham Park and at the Quaker Meeting House at the end of the walk.

The walk will go ahead whatever the weather, unless the Met Office advises otherwise or there is serious transport disruption.
